What to Expect in a Sound Healing Certification Program

A comprehensive sound healing certification program covers theoretical and practical aspects of sound therapy. Students learn about the science of sound frequencies, human energy fields, and the therapeutic effects of different instruments. Hands-on training helps them develop techniques for one-on-one and group healing sessions. Many programs also include case studies and supervised practice, ensuring students gain real-world experience before becoming certified practitioners.
